Abstract
The double container comprises an outer container having positioned therein substantially centrally a smaller inner container. Each mouth of both containers lie in approximately the same plane. Additionally, both containers are closed by the same single cap. The outer container may be longitudinally compressed so that access to the inner container may be obtained due to the elastomeric material with which at least the lower portion of the outer container is constructed. The inner container may be removed from its closed position to expose the contents therein to the contents in the outer container all within the outer container.

8 Claims
-
1. A double container comprising an outer container having at least the lower portion thereof constructed of elastomeric material, said lower portion having a relatively smooth bottom and a relatively smooth side wall;
- a section of that portion above the said lower portion having flexible corrugations whereby the outer container may Be shortened lengthwise due to the said corrugations, said container having a mouth, a closure mounted to close the mouth of said outer container, an inner container, said inner container being spaced from the sides and bottom of said outer container, said inner container having a mouth at one end thereof, the mouth of the outer container and the inner container extend in the same longitudinal direction, said closure having depending means for closing the mouth of said inner container, said lower portion being of relatively thin flexible elastomeric material whereby the said lower portion may be inwardly deformed when the outer container is shortened lengthwise and the inner container may be grasped by deforming the lower portion about the lower portion of the inner container.
-
2. The double container of claim 1 wherein the outer container has a cylindrical configuration.
-
3. The double container of claim 1 wherein the inner container has a cylindrical configuration.
-
4. The double container of claim 2 wherein the inner container has a cylindrical configuration.
-
5. The double container of claim 1 wherein the closure has a depending skirt having screw means and the mouth of said outer container has mating screw means whereby the closure may be screwed onto the outer container.
-
6. The double container of claim 1 wherein the underside of the closure has a plug means adapted to fit the mouth of the inner container by friction fit.
-
7. The double container of claim 5 wherein the underside of the closure has a plug means adapted to fit the mouth of the inner container by friction fit.
-
8. The container of claim 1 having liquid material both in the inner and outer containers.
